Abstract
The treatment of the inelastic collisions with electrons and hydrogen atoms are the main source of uncertainties in non-Local Thermodynamic Equilibrium (LTE) spectral line computations. We report, in this research note, quantum mechanical data for 369 collisional transitions of Mg I with electrons for temperatures comprised between 500 and 20000 K. We give the quantum mechanical data in terms of effective collision strengths, more practical for non-LTE studies.
